Murder at Castle Nathria is Hearthstone's 21st expansion, featuring new 135 collectible cards released on August 2, 2022.[1] The expansion depicts a dinner party in Castle Nathria hosted by Murder at Castle NathriaSire Denathrius, where he unexpectedly meets his end. Detective Murder at Castle NathriaMurloc Holmes has been called to solve the case and determine which of the ten suspects committed the crime.

Murder at Castle Nathria features a new keyword - Infuse - which allows cards to get more powerful as friendly minions die. The expansion also introduces a brand new card type - Location. Locations are played onto the battlefield for an initial cost, and then have an ability that can be activated for free on your turns, each time for a powerful effect.

Murder at Castle Nathria card set features 135 collectible cards, which can be recognized with a special watermark (the Venthyr symbol) behind the card text, not found on other cards.

The Mini-set, Maw and Disorder, is also considered to be part of the Murder at Castle Nathria set, and all 35 cards are categorized as "New Cards" in Collection manager.

Themes[]

Ten Suspicious Suspects[]

Murloc Holmes full
Sire Denathrius had a lot of enemies. And it just so happens that 10 of them were under his roof at the time of his demise! Each class will have a Legendary minion that is a prime suspect in Sire Denathrius’s murder. They all have the means and the motive, but it is up to you and Murloc Holmes to determine who is guilty.[1]

New Keyword: Infuse[]

Priest of the Deceased full
Priest of the Deceased (Infused) full
Anima, drawn from wayward souls, powers all the Shadowlands—and those who consume it! Cards with the Infuse keyword sit in your hand and absorb anima from your friendly minions as they die. After the specified number of friendly minions die while the Infuse card is in your hand, the Infuse card transforms into a more powerful version. Infuse your cards to unlock their full power![1]

New Card Type: Locations[]

Muck Pools full
Castle Nathria is like no place Hearthstone has ever been before. Explore the castle grounds through the all-new Location card type! Locations are played onto the battlefield for an initial cost, and then have an ability that can be activated for free on your turns, each time for a powerful effect. Each activation costs 1 Durability and has a 1-turn Cooldown. Every class gets their own Location card in Castle Nathria which represents where they claim their suspect was at the time of the murder, and synergizes with the themes of the class.[1]

Venthyr[]

Prince Renathal full

Revendreth is home to the vampiric venthyr: punishers of the unworthy, charged with rehabilitating the sinful souls sent to them by the Arbiter.

The Suspicious[]

A scrapped concept from The Witchwood,[2] these minions Discover a card and represent the same options to the opposing player, allowing them to gain a copy if the same card was guessed correctly. Gnomenapper (Removed card) was one of the scrapped cards during The Witchwood development that used this effect.

Revendreth[]

Afterlives - Revendreth WoW

"A realm of looming keeps and gothic villages, Revendreth is home to the venthyr, the harvesters of sin. The wretched souls who arrive here may find penance for their misdeeds... or merely indulge the appetites of their keepers."

Revendreth Landscape WoW

Revendreth landscape.

"Souls burdened with prodigious pride in life are sent to Revendreth at their end. Anima is tormented from them to feed the appetites of their keepers. Learned humility was supposed to be the destiny of the souls entrusted to our care. I fear those archaic ways no longer have a place within Revendreth. Pride: It is the principal reason mortal souls are delivered unto Revendreth, we exist to relieve them of that troublesome sin and to be blessed by their anima."

The major vista of the region is its gigantic castle, sprawling over a misty forest. The castle's entry ward itself is suffering disrepair, as are the buildings and structures across the grounds, as the region is deprived of new souls and their precious Anima. Sinstones, gravestones with the soul's crimes listed upon it, litter each pathway. Souls sent here can etch these sins off their stones over time as they are prepared for the afterlife by the venthyr. The fog-filled forest is where the venthyr schedule hunts on tortured souls, sending them out with a false sense of hope and security, then track them down and "humble" them. The catacombs are where souls are locked away for eons until sufficiently humbled to warrant being transferred to the Halls of Atonement. There all souls must go through the Ritual of Absolution at least once to be cleansed of sin fully, and the Ritual of Judgment for their final fate to be decided. Some souls, however, are kept in Castle Nathria for the nobles to enjoy. Another notable area is the Ember Ward, found on the western side of the region. There the Light has actually broken through and is extremely harmful to Revendreth's residents. The crumbled walls and fragmented landscape is due to the anima drought and devourers.

Castle Nathria[]

Castle Nathria WoW

Castle Nathria

Castle Nathria is a raid in World of Warcraft: Shadowlands. It is a Gothic castle located in Revendreth, a winged raid starting with 2 wings with 3 bosses each. The raid has 10 bosses in total.

Long has Murder at Castle NathriaSire Denathrius ruled the denizens of Revendreth as they harvested anima from prideful souls. But as drought and fear gripped the Shadowlands, Denathrius revealed his true loyalties. In defiance of his former Master, the noble Murder at Castle NathriaPrince Renathal gathers his few remaining allies for a desperate mission to infiltrate Castle Nathria and remove Denathrius from power.

Denathrius[]

Denathrius Address WoW
Denathrius Afterlives WoW
Denathrius WoW

Murder at Castle NathriaSire Denathrius in World of Warcraft.

Sire Denathrius, the Master, is the creator and the former leader of the realm of Revendreth and its inhabitants, the venthyr people, which he ruled from Castle Nathria. Calculating and methodical, Denathrius is ancient beyond measure and one of the most powerful beings in all the Shadowlands. He created the venthyr in his likeness, forging them from the souls of the redeemed. The first venthyr were born directly from Denathrius' will, such as Prince Renathal who considers him his father. He is also the creator of the nathrezim, cruel and cunning beings with the purpose to be the greatest spies and infiltrators in all of reality, in order to spread the influence of Death throughout the cosmos.

In a midst of a rebellion caused by the anima drought that's swept over the Shadowlands, rumors suggested that Denathrius may no longer be fit for the role of Master of Revendreth. Crowning a new Sire could return the plane to its former glory, or leave it mired in the same decadence and sin it is charged with cleansing. Consequently, Denathrius beseeched Azeroth's champions to help him quell the rebellion led by Prince Renathal, which threatened to destroy the venthyr way of life, but not all was as Denathrius claimed.

In truth, Denathrius has been corrupted by the very sins Revendreth swore to punish. Cooperating with Zovaal the Jailer, he wished to rule all the Shadowlands and to free the Jailer from his bonds by channeling massive amounts of anima into the Maw. Although he accomplished his plan, he was later defeated by the Maw Walkers in his own castle, while his essence was absorbed by his sentient blade Remornia. At Dawnkeep, Denathrius was placed under the watch of the naaru Z'rali to fulfill his repentance, until he was freed by the nathrezim who infiltrated Revendreth.

History[]

Development[]

The Hearthstone team has been considering the idea of a murder mystery expansion for a long time, even during The Witchwood.[2][4]

When asked about how the idea for the theme of murder mystery was introduced to the Hearthstone development team, Cora Georgiou, who led the design for this expansion, offered a lot of insight. “The idea for a murder mystery in Hearthstone is something that I’ve wanted to see for a long time. Every brainstorm session that we do for a new expansion, we bring the whole team together and everybody sort of comes out with what they think would be a really awesome idea for an expansion. And for several sets, the first thing that I pitched was: let's do a murder mystery.”[4]

According to Cora, the general idea and basic design for the theme were already in mind, but they didn’t know where they wanted to set the expansion. “A lot of the development team had Gilneas in mind but that had already been done for the Witchwood. Around this time, Shadowlands had come out but this was before even the Raid at Nathria. Someone had suggested Revendreth, where the Venthyr throw parties at the Ember Court so if you wanted to do a murder mystery party set it’s kinda perfect. So, I did some research, and I came away saying, what’s cooler than a murder mystery dinner party is a murder mystery dinner party with vampires. It was really just perfect.”[4]

Teasers and announcement[]

On June 25th, 2022, the official Hearthstone Twitter posted a short video of Castle Nathria, where a painting of Murder at Castle NathriaSire Denathrius was seen cracked. The tweet had the accompanying text of "Spotted—Castle resident losing something nobody even knew he had. His life."[5] It was announced in the video that reveals would begin on June 27th.

On June 27th, the expansion was announced along with new cards being revealed.

Trivia[]

  • Murder at Castle Nathria was the second expansion to introduce a new card type, after the hero cards in Knights of the Frozen Throne.
  • Many things seen in Murder at Castle Nathria, including the theme and card types, were originally concepts for The Witchwood, including:
  • The atmospheres of Revendreth and Gilneas in general are also very similar to each other, featuring Victorian English themes.
